Quantitative dose-response analysis untangles host bottlenecks to enteric infection
28 Jan 2023
Abstract excerpt
Host bottlenecks prevent many infections before the onset of disease by eliminating invading pathogens. By monitoring the diversity of a barcoded population of the diarrhea causing bacterium Citrobacter rodentium during colonization of its natural host, mice, we determine the number of cells that found the infection by establishing a replicative niche.
